在 iOS 游戏中,存档位置通常由游戏本身决定,但你可以通过以下几种方式来管理或查看存档的位置:
一、iOS 系统默认的存档位置
iOS 游戏的存档通常存储在以下路径中:
1. iOS 设备的文件系统
- 路径:
/var/mobile/Applications/APP_ID/ - 说明:
APP_ID是你的应用 ID(如com.example.game)。- 存档文件通常存储在
Documents或Library目录下。
二、查看存档位置的方法
1. 通过 Xcode 查看
如果你是开发者,可以使用 Xcode 查看你的游戏的存档位置:
步骤:
- 打开 Xcode。
- 选择你的项目。
- 点击 Project Navigator(左侧面板)。
- 找到你的 Target(游戏)。
- 点击 Build Settings。
- 在 User-Defined 中查找 "User Defaults" 或 "Documents Directory"。
- 例如:
Document Directory:/var/mobile/Applications/APP_ID/Documents/Library Directory:/var/mobile/Applications/APP_ID/Library/
- 例如:
2. 通过终端查看(适用于开发者)
如果你是开发者,可以使用终端(Terminal)查看存档位置:
命令示例:
ls /var/mobile/Applications/APP_ID/Documents/
三、游戏内部的存档管理
大多数 iOS 游戏会通过以下方式管理存档:
1. 使用 NSUserDefaults
- 游戏会使用
NSUserDefaults来存储玩家的偏好、进度等数据。 - 存档文件通常位于:
/var/mobile/Applications/APP_ID/Library/NSUserDefaults/
2. 使用 Documents 目录
- 游戏会将存档文件存放在
Documents目录下。 - 存档文件通常以
.sqlite、.plist、.json等格式存储。
四、用户端查看存档位置(非开发者)
如果你是普通用户,无法直接查看游戏的存档位置,但你可以通过以下方式:
1. 查看游戏的安装路径
- 打开 文件管理器(如 Finder)。
- 找到你的游戏安装路径,通常是:
/var/mobile/Applications/APP_ID/ - 在该路径下,查看
Documents和Library目录。
五、常见存档文件类型
.plist:存储用户偏好。.sqlite:存储游戏进度(如 RPG、策略类)。.json:存储游戏状态(如 2D 游戏)。
六、总结
| 类型 | 路径 |
|---|---|
| 用户偏好 | /var/mobile/Applications/APP_ID/Library/NSUserDefaults/ |
| 游戏进度 | /var/mobile/Applications/APP_ID/Documents/ |
| 存档文件 | /var/mobile/Applications/APP_ID/Library/ |
七、注意事项
- iOS 系统限制:iOS 系统对文件访问权限有限,普通用户无法直接访问游戏的存档文件。
- 游戏存档:大多数游戏的存档是加密的,无法直接复制或查看。
如果你有具体的游戏名称或开发工具(如 Unity、Xcode、GameMaker Studio 等),我可以提供更详细的指导。欢迎补充信息!